What is the quantity of charge, in Faraday units, required for the reduction of 3.5 moles of Cr ₂ O 7²⁻ in acid medium?

Options

  1. A10.5
  2. B6.0
  3. C21.0
  4. D3.0

Correct answer

C. 21.0

Step-by-step solution

The reduction half-reaction for the dichromate ion in an acidic medium is given by: Cr ₂ O ₇²⁻ + 14 H ⁺ + 6 e ⁻ 2 Cr ³⁺ + 7 H ₂ O From the balanced equation, it is observed that 1 mole of Cr ₂ O ₇²⁻ requires 6 moles of electrons for its reduction. Since 1 mole of electrons corresponds to 1 Faraday of charge, 1 mole of Cr ₂ O ₇²⁻ requires 6 Faraday of charge. For 3.5 moles of Cr ₂ O ₇²⁻ , the total charge required is: Charge = 3.5 moles 6 Faraday/mole = 21.0 Faraday Answer: 21.0
